Description

Dimethoxymethyl(Phenylmethoxy)Silane is a specialized organosilicon compound that serves as a versatile building block and coupling agent in advanced material synthesis. Its molecular structure, featuring both methoxy and phenylmethoxy groups, makes it a valuable precursor for introducing specific organic functionalities into siloxane networks and surfaces. This compound is essential for manufacturers and R&D teams in the silicone polymer, coatings, and adhesives industries seeking to modify material properties such as hydrophobicity, adhesion, and thermal stability. Its reactivity allows for tailored material design, enabling performance enhancements in demanding applications.

Application

  • Silicone Resin & Polymer Modification: Used as a functional monomer or cross-linking agent to introduce phenyl-containing groups, enhancing the heat resistance, refractive index, and mechanical properties of silicone polymers.
  • Surface Treatment & Coupling Agent: Acts as an adhesion promoter and surface modifier for inorganic materials like glass, metals, and minerals, improving compatibility with organic resins in composite materials.
  • Specialty Coatings & Sealants: Incorporated into formulations to develop high-performance, weather-resistant coatings, water-repellent sealants, and release agents with tailored surface characteristics.
  • Pharmaceutical & Agro-chemical Intermediates: Serves as a key synthetic intermediate in the production of more complex organosilicon molecules for life science applications.
  • Electronic Materials: Utilized in the synthesis of siloxane-based dielectric materials, encapsulants, or passivation layers for microelectronics due to its controllable reactivity.
  • Research & Development: A valuable reagent for academic and industrial R&D focused on novel organosilicon chemistry, hybrid materials, and nanotechnology.

Basic Information

Product Name Dimethoxymethyl(Phenylmethoxy)Silane
CAS No. 83817-66-7
Molecular Formula C10H16O3Si
Molecular Weight 212.32 g/mol
Synonyms Methyl(dimethoxy)(phenylmethoxy)silane; (Phenylmethoxy)dimethoxymethylsilane; Benzyloxydimethoxymethylsilane; Dimethoxy(methyl)(phenoxymethyl)silane; Silane, dimethoxymethyl(phenylmethoxy)-; Methyl(dimethoxy)(benzyloxy)silane; Benzyl Alcohol, (dimethoxymethylsilyl) Ether

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). This product is hygroscopic (moisture-sensitive) and should be handled under a dry inert atmosphere (e.g., nitrogen or argon) to prevent hydrolysis and maintain stability. Keep away from heat, sparks, open flames, and incompatible materials such as strong acids, bases, and oxidizing agents.
